How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Tisch Mills?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Tisch Mills Studio Apartments | $976 | $816 | $1,100 |
| Tisch Mills 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,041 | $710 | $1,806 |
| Tisch Mills 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,352 | $840 | $2,500 |
| Tisch Mills 3 Bedroom Apartments | $1,568 | $979 | $2,595 |
| Tisch Mills 4 Bedroom Apartments | $1,400 | $1,400 | $1,400 |
How much does it cost to rent a home in Tisch Mills?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| 2 Bedroom Homes | $1,262 | $795 | $2,200 |
| 3 Bedroom Homes | $2,015 | $945 | $5,500 |
| 4 Bedroom Homes | $1,875 | $1,875 | $1,875 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Tisch Mills
What is the current pricing and availability for apartments for rent in Tisch Mills, WI?
As of today, August 06, 2026, there are currently 78 available Tisch Mills apartments priced from $710 to $2,595, with an average monthly rent of $1,283.
What is the current price range for One Bedroom Tisch Mills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Tisch Mills ranges from $710 to $1,806 with an average monthly rent of $1,041.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Tisch Mills c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Tisch Mills range from $840 to $2,500.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$1,352.
